root/src/apps/icon-o-matic/shape/commands/InsertPointCommand.cpp
/*
 * Copyright 2006, Haiku.
 * Distributed under the terms of the MIT License.
 *
 * Authors:
 *              Stephan Aßmus <superstippi@gmx.de>
 */

#include "InsertPointCommand.h"

#include <new>
#include <stdio.h>

#include <Catalog.h>
#include <Locale.h>

#include "VectorPath.h"


#undef B_TRANSLATION_CONTEXT
#define B_TRANSLATION_CONTEXT "Icon-O-Matic-InsertPointCmd"


using std::nothrow;

// constructor
InsertPointCommand::InsertPointCommand(VectorPath* path,
                                                                          int32 index,
                                                                          const int32* selected,
                                                                          int32 count)
        : PathCommand(path),
          fIndex(index),
          fOldSelection(NULL),
          fOldSelectionCount(count)
{
        if (fPath && (!fPath->GetPointsAt(fIndex, fPoint, fPointIn, fPointOut)
                                  || !fPath->GetPointOutAt(fIndex - 1, fPreviousOut)
                                  || !fPath->GetPointInAt(fIndex + 1, fNextIn))) {
                fPath = NULL;
        }
        if (fOldSelectionCount > 0 && selected) {
                fOldSelection = new (nothrow) int32[count];
                memcpy(fOldSelection, selected, count * sizeof(int32));
        }
}

// destructor
InsertPointCommand::~InsertPointCommand()
{
        delete[] fOldSelection;
}

// Perform
status_t
InsertPointCommand::Perform()
{
        status_t status = InitCheck();
        if (status < B_OK)
                return status;

        // path point is already added
        // but in/out points might still have changed
        fPath->GetPointInAt(fIndex, fPointIn);
        fPath->GetPointOutAt(fIndex, fPointOut);

        return status;
}

// Undo
status_t
InsertPointCommand::Undo()
{
        status_t status = InitCheck();
        if (status < B_OK)
                return status;

        AutoNotificationSuspender _(fPath);

        // remove the inserted point
        if (fPath->RemovePoint(fIndex)) {
                // remember current previous "out" and restore it
                BPoint previousOut = fPreviousOut;
                fPath->GetPointOutAt(fIndex - 1, fPreviousOut);
                fPath->SetPointOut(fIndex - 1, previousOut);
                // remember current next "in" and restore it
                BPoint nextIn = fNextIn;
                fPath->GetPointInAt(fIndex, fNextIn);
                fPath->SetPointIn(fIndex, nextIn);
                // restore previous selection
                _Select(fOldSelection, fOldSelectionCount);
        } else {
                status = B_ERROR;
        }

        return status;
}

// Redo
status_t
InsertPointCommand::Redo()
{
        status_t status = InitCheck();
        if (status < B_OK)
                return status;


        AutoNotificationSuspender _(fPath);

        // insert point again
        if (fPath->AddPoint(fPoint, fIndex)) {
                fPath->SetPoint(fIndex, fPoint, fPointIn, fPointOut, true);
                // remember current previous "out" and restore it
                BPoint previousOut = fPreviousOut;
                fPath->GetPointOutAt(fIndex - 1, fPreviousOut);
                fPath->SetPointOut(fIndex - 1, previousOut);
                // remember current next "in" and restore it
                BPoint nextIn = fNextIn;
                fPath->GetPointInAt(fIndex + 1, fNextIn);
                fPath->SetPointIn(fIndex + 1, nextIn);
                // select inserted point
                _Select(&fIndex, 1);
        } else {
                status = B_ERROR;
        }

        return status;
}

// GetName
void
InsertPointCommand::GetName(BString& name)
{
        name << B_TRANSLATE("Insert vertex");
}
